The Branch Project works with children and young people who have experienced Child Sexual Exploitation (CSE) or are worried about it.

CSE is a type of child abuse that happens when a young person is encouraged, or forced, to take part in sexual activity in exchange for something. The reward might be presents, money, alcohol or simply just the promise of love and affection.
